How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Long Beach?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Long Beach Studio Apartments | $2,061 | $1,250 | $4,167 |
| Long Beach 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,496 | $850 | $7,458 |
Long Beach 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,186 | $1,695 | $9,543 |
| Long Beach 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,698 | $1,295 | $9,350 |
| Long Beach 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,525 | $2,595 | $5,750 |
| Long Beach 5 Bedroom Apartments | $5,114 | $3,395 | $7,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Long Beach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Long Beach with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Long Beach is at Northpointe listed at $1,383.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Long Beach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Long Beach is $3,186.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Long Beach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Long Beach is a 2,158 square feet unit starting from $6,995 at Ocean Center.
What is the average size for Long Beach 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Long Beach is currently 1,006 sq ft.
